Output 6ec8d2f89f686d82d56f7035d88546557dfdc35c446ad91758d75d24256a92e9:13

value
1597666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5ca373371c967d1992822d3d8608b965e75ebf1 OP_EQUAL
address
3KiqHXG6rJR6uA373q6678eNyChXCRZ5Hp
transaction
6ec8d2f89f686d82d56f7035d88546557dfdc35c446ad91758d75d24256a92e9
confirmations
282730
spent
true